6. Historical ecology of the Greater Burgan oilfield : economy, technology, politics, and workers
University essay from Uppsala universitet/Institutionen för arkeologi och antik historiaAbstract : This thesis examines the current state of crude oil extraction and production in the Greater Burgan oilfield, Kuwait's largest and oldest oilfield. This thesis is based on interviews with oilfield workers, analyses of official documents from the Kuwaiti government and the Kuwait Oil Company (KOC), and my own experience as an oilfield worker in Kuwait. 7. Attitudes in Consuming Green Products: Exploring Chinese Consumers in the Beauty Industry
University essay from Jönköping University/IHH, FöretagsekonomiAbstract : Background: China's rapidly growing beauty consumer market has led to environmental deterioration and Chinese citizens are aware of this important issue, however, despite positive pro-environmental attitudes, consumers are reluctant to buy green products. This issue is known as the attitude-behavior gap, and existing research lacks information on how this gap operates in the Chinese beauty market. READ MORE

8. Just Sustainability Transitions in the Blue Economy: Towards Blue Justice in Small-Scale Artisanal Fisheries in the Pacific of Costa Rica
University essay from Lunds universitet/Ekonomisk-historiska institutionenAbstract : The blue economy emerged as sustainable, inclusive and equitable alternative to traditional oceans economy. However, the current paradigm of oceans as development spaces has led to an acceleration of competing uses of marine resources causing ecosystem deterioration and human rights abuses that disproportionately affect vulnerable small-scale fisheries. 9. Costs of reducing phosphorus runoff from horse pastures in Sweden
University essay from SLU/Dept. of EconomicsAbstract : Eutrophication is an environmental issue that causes deterioration of inland waters and oceans. It is induced by leaching of nutrients from different sources. One such source that has been getting attention lately is the leaching of nutrients from horse pastures. READ MORE
